What is quad? - Definition from WhatIs.com

A quad (pronounced KWAHD) is a unit in a set of something that comes in four units.The term is sometimes used to describe each of the four numbers that constitute an Internet Protocol ( IP) address.Thus, an Internet address in its numeric form (which is also sometimes called a dot address) consists of four quads separated by "dots" (periods).For example:
